    Don Stonesifer
    Don Stonesifer

    Contemporary Era:
    1999 Inductee



    Stonesifer was a three-year letterwinner in football and one of a long line of standout ends at Northwestern. He established Big Ten records with 28 catches for 394 yards in six conference games as a senior captain, and also set the school's single-game mark with 13 receptions against Minnesota - a mark that stood for 32 years.

    Overall, he led the Wildcats that year with 42 catches for 560 yards. Stonesifer was a unanimous All-Big Ten and All-America selection in 1950. In addition, he played in the 1951 College All-Star Game, the East-West Shrine Game and the Senior Bowl.
